Whenever we have croissants or petit pains au chocolat leftover in our guesthouse, we turn them into a yummy bread and butter pudding for the following day’s breakfast. We often make smoothies instead of just serving orange juice on its own… I tend not to add yoghurt as we offer that separately with a compote of fresh fruit. My smoothie base is orange juice and a banana (to thicken it a little) and then I add whatever seasonal fruit we have on hand… [...]
